DIY Pressure Washing: Tips and Techniques

Give your deck a fresh new look with DIY pressure washing! It's a simple process that can dramatically enhance the curb appeal of your estate. First, analyze the surface you want to clean for any damage. Then, select a pressure washer with an appropriate PSI rating based on the type of material you're working with.

Always wear protective clothing, including goggles and gloves. When using the pressure washer, start at a distance of about 12 inches from the surface and work in overlapping strokes. Don't overspray as this can harm the surface.

When you're done, rinse the area thoroughly with water and let it air dry. For stubborn stains, you can use a pressure washing solution. Relax and admire your freshly cleaned house!

Frequent Mistakes to Avoid When Pressure Washing

Pressure washing can be a fantastic way to clean your house, but there are some common mistakes that you should stay away from. One of the most frequent mistakes is using the inappropriate pressure setting. Too much pressure can harm your materials, while too little pressure won't be useful. It's also important to don appropriate protective equipment like eye protection and gloves. And finally, always read the operating guidelines before you start pressure washing.

  • Maintain a appropriate distance from the area you are cleaning.
  • Test the pressure washer in an hidden area first to confirm it's working properly.
